He opened his first Victoria's Secret shop, which specialized in lingerie, 16 years ago in the Stanford Shopping Center with a $40,000 bank loan and $40,000 borrowed from relatives. [8] Raymond sold the company to Les Wexner, creator of Limited Stores Inc of Columbus, Ohio, for $1 million. [10][17][18], For approximately a year after the sale to Wexner, Raymond stayed on as president of Victoria's Secret while working towards the start of his next company, an upscale store for children called My Child's Destiny.
